Key Growth Drivers

  1. Consumer Demand for Transparency

Modern consumers are scrutinizing ingredient labels more closely, favoring products with fewer, familiar, and natural ingredients. This behavioral shift is influencing purchasing decisions across all demographics.

  1. Clean-Label Reformulation Across Categories

Food manufacturers are actively reformulating products to remove:

  • Artificial preservatives
  • Synthetic colors and flavors
  • Chemical-sounding additives

This is creating sustained demand for natural alternatives that deliver equivalent functionality.

  1. Regulatory and Policy Influence

Governments and food safety authorities are tightening regulations around labeling and ingredient disclosure, accelerating the transition toward clean-label compliance.

  1. Growth of Health and Wellness Trends

Clean-label products are often associated with healthier and safer consumption, even when nutritional differences are minimal, reinforcing their market appeal.

Market Challenges

Functional Trade-Offs

Replacing synthetic ingredients with natural alternatives can impact:

  • Shelf life
  • Texture
  • Stability

Achieving the same performance requires advanced formulation expertise.

Higher Costs

Clean-label ingredients are often more expensive, creating pricing pressures—especially in cost-sensitive markets.

Supply Chain Complexity

Sourcing consistent, high-quality natural ingredients can be challenging due to agricultural variability and limited scalability.

Emerging Opportunities

Natural Preservatives and Shelf-Life Solutions

There is strong demand for plant-based and fermentation-derived preservatives that maintain product stability without synthetic chemicals.

Plant-Based and Alternative Ingredients

The rise of plant-based foods is accelerating demand for clean-label binders, emulsifiers, and texturizers.

Regional and Local Sourcing

Consumers are increasingly valuing locally sourced and traceable ingredients, creating opportunities for regional suppliers.

Regional Analysis

North America: Consumer-Led Transformation

High awareness and strong retail dynamics are driving widespread adoption of clean-label products across categories.

Europe: Regulation-Driven Leadership

Strict labeling laws and consumer expectations are making Europe a benchmark market for clean-label standards.

Asia-Pacific: High-Growth Opportunity

Rising incomes, urbanization, and increasing awareness are driving adoption, particularly in:

  • China
  • India
  • Southeast Asia

Latin America & MEA: Emerging Adoption

Gradual market expansion is supported by growing middle-class populations and exposure to global food trends.
